Hello PH communityπŸ‘‹ David here. Today, I'm thrilled to introduce you to a tool that's going to make your life as a Design System Lead / Expert a whole lot easier. πŸ˜‰ We understand the challenges of managing and scaling design systems. It can be a complex battlefield, at a high cost. With Componly, you can easily distinguish which components in a project come from your design system, and which do not. This empowers you to monitor usage and performance, strengthening your system's value for wider adoption. ⭐ Automatic audits * With the Adoption Map, you can scan all your project pages, sort them by coverage percentage, identify areas that need improvement, and adjust your roadmap accordingly. ⭐ Full Suite of Features for Seamless Growth * Get your design system organized in no time with the user-friendly interface. * Powerful analytics * CLI * Desktop App to highlight what is not from your DS * Reports that you can share to your shareholders. As a React developer myself, I've worked on several design systems, and improving adoption has always been a challenge. Dealing with custom components and overrides can take a while. With Componly, it becomes much more easier. Thanks, feel free to share your thoughts and questions with the team πŸ˜ŠπŸš€

Great idea. Wouldn't we normally include everything in our design system?
Mehdi Bachali
Hi @kingromstar, we typically include components meant for reuse across projects. However, sometimes developers still opt for custom components instead of the designated DS ones. Locating and updating these can be a real challenge. Componly automates this process with real-time data, and the data is updated at every new PR as Componly can be connected to the CI/CD pipeline. Means you have real-time data adoption :)
